Army NCO killed in suspicious circumstances in J
Bhaderwah, Jammu, Feb 5 (UNI) A Non-Commissioned Officer (NCO), deployed in counter-insurgency operations, was found shot dead under suspicious circumstances in an Army camp here in Doda district today, official sources said.
The body of Naik Krishan Kumar of 4 Rashtriya Rifles (RR) was brought from Sarna Army Camp here to the Sub-District Hospital, Bhaderwah, with a bullet wound this morning, sources said.
''Apparently, a bullet seems to have pierced the NCO from the back shoulder side and came out from the right chest,'' officials at hospital told UNI.
However, suspecting something fishy in the incident, police have registered a case under section 174 of CrPC and started an investigation.
When contacted, no comments were made by the Nagrota-based XVI Corps.
